A major factor in Punjab’s medical and dental admissions is the University of Health Sciences (UHS). Thousands of students eagerly await the UHS MBBS & BDS Merit Lists each year to learn if they have been accepted into the medical or dental college of their choice. These merit lists are created using the government-approved weighting formula, the candidate’s FSC scores, and their MDCAT score.

For both MBBS and BDS programs, UHS publishes several lists, such as the Provisional Merit List, First Merit List, Second Merit List, and Third Merit List. Initially, the provisional list allows students to review their data and request corrections if needed. Subsequently, the official merit lists validate the final admissions and confirm the allocation of seats across medical and dental colleges.

UHS Affiliated Medical and Dental Colleges
Many UHS-affiliated medical and dental colleges in Punjab offer MBBS and BDS programs in Pakistan. These institutions follow the University of Health Sciences curriculum and admission policies, ensuring standardized, high-quality medical education. Below is the list of UHS-affiliated public sector medical colleges that accept students through the UHS MBBS & BDS admission process each year.
Medical College
- Allama Iqbal Medical College, Lahore
- Gujranwala Medical College, Gujranwala
- Khawaja Muhammad Safdar Medical College, Sialkot
- Ameer-ud-Din Medical College, Lahore
- D.G. Khan Medical College, Dera Ghazi Khan
- Fatima Jinnah Medical University (for women), Lahore
- King Edward Medical University, Lahore KEMU
- Nawaz Sharif Medical College, University of Gujrat
- Nishtar Medical College NMC, Multan
- Punjab Medical College PMC, Faisalabad
- Quaid-e-Azam Medical College, Bahawalpur
- Rawalpindi Medical College, Rawalpindi RMC or RMU
- Sahiwal Medical College, Sahiwal SMC
- Services Institute of Medical Sciences, Lahore SIMS
- Sheikh Zayed Medical College Rahim Yar Khan
- Sargodha Medical College, University of Sargodha
Dental Colleges
- Montmorency College of Dentistry, in Lahore
- Dental Institute Punjab Medical College, in Faisalabad
- Nishtar Institute of Dentistry, in Multan
UHS Aggregate Formula
Students can calculate their UHS MDCAT Aggregate from the following:
- SSC or Equivalent Marks = 10%
- FSC or Equivalent Marks = 40%
- NUMS MDCAT Entry Test Marks = 50%
UHS Closing Merits
The closing merit for MBBS in UHS medical colleges is generally very high due to strong competition among applicants. Although the closing merit changes every year, it mainly depends on overall student performance in MDCAT and FSC. Additionally, the closing merit varies from college to college, with top-ranked medical institutions having higher merit requirements compared to others.
